The Rossignol Strato 102

A couple of days ago was my 102nd day out skiing for the season. While I was happy that I had skied well beyond my age, my attention went to the number 102 and with it, brought back the picture of Rossignol’s famous iteration of its very successful ski “Strato”, under the “Strato 102” moniker.

In American culture the number 101 often represents a time of new beginnings and growth. If you've been feeling stuck or unhappy, this signals a great time to make a change. It also denotes an introductory course at college or university in the subject specified, so from there, one could infer that “102” was the next best thing or as the expression goes “one good turn deserves another”. 

I also asked Maurice Woehrle, who ran R&D at Rossignol for many years, he said that, as he recalls, there was no specific reason behind that number, except perhaps that “2” was marking a minute progress in the ski finishing technique. There was indeed an attempt, for a year or so, to replace the lacquer and varnish covering the ABS top by some wax that would have been cheaper to produce.

Finally, I also tried to contact Rossignol’s former CEO Laurent Boix-Vives in Paradise where he is currently on vacation. He was the one who resurrected the company thanks to his financial savvy. He said, "One hundred and two? You know, where I am now, figures don't interest me anymore! »  

So you know now the story behind that name and don’t be surprised if someday, we see a new Rossignol Strato 103 marking a quantum leap on that successful breed of skis...
